Greenlight Networks Partners with Boys and Girls Club on Holiday Giveback

CHAMBERSBURG, PA (November 24, 2025)Greenlight Networks (“Greenlight”), a leading fiber-to-the-home internet service provider, today announced its new holiday giveback campaign in partnership with The Boys and Girls Club of Chambersburg and Shippensburg. For every Chambersburg resident who places an order for Greenlight fiber internet between November 24 and December 31, Greenlight will donate $50 to The Boys and Girls Club of Chambersburg and Shippensburg, giving local residents the opportunity to support youth in the community while gaining access to fast, reliable fiber connectivity.

 

Greenlight is also pleased to introduce a new affordable package, a 350 Mbps fiber internet plan for just $35 per month, available to Chambersburg residents. As part of this launch, Greenlight will continue its commitment to the community by contributing $50 to the Boys & Girls Club of Chambersburg and Shippensburg for every order placed for this plan and all others through the end of the year. This offering reflects Greenlight’s ongoing efforts to put customers first and tailor services to meet local needs.

Building upon its partnership with The Boys and Girls Club, Greenlight is also sponsoring the Club’s annual Santa’s Clubhouse Tour, bringing holiday cheer to children and families across Chambersburg and Shippensburg. Families can enjoy visits with Santa, holiday activities, a Cocoa Crawl, and a scavenger hunt. Dates and locations of Santa’s Clubhouse include:

 

·         Downtown Chambersburg Cocoa Crawl: December 5, 5:30–8:00 pm

·         Downtown Chambersburg Scavenger Hunt: December 6, 9:00 am–12:00 pm

·         Henry’s Pharmacy in Shippensburg: December 13, 9:00 am–12:00 pm

·         Corning Credit Union in Chambersburg Visits with Santa (pets welcome): December 16, 4:30–6:30 pm

The funds from Greenlight’s holiday giveback campaign will directly support The Boys and Girls Club’s programs, including mentorship initiatives, health and wellness activities, after-school programs, and more. These contributions help provide children and families in Chambersburg and Shippensburg with safe places to learn, play, and stay active throughout the year.

 

Alongside these community efforts, Greenlight is continuing to expand its fiber network across South-Central Pennsylvania, bringing high-speed, reliable internet to more homes and businesses. Chambersburg is a key market in Greenlights broader growth across the state, following recent network buildouts in Northeastern Pennsylvania, including Scranton, Blakely, Throop, and surrounding communities, further strengthening Greenlight’s regional footprint. About Greenlight Networks
Greenlight Networks is a provider of ultra-high-speed fiber Internet, delivering symmetrical speeds of up to 8 Gbps to residential and small business customers. Since its founding in 2011, Greenlight has built, owns, and operates a state-of-the-art fiber-optic network, providing fast, reliable connectivity. Greenlight’s network provides access to more than 300,000 homes and small businesses with a strong presence throughout New York State, Northeast and South-Central Pennsylvania, and Baltimore, Maryland.
